Fire chief says stove caused Harrison County blaze Tuesday night

Harrison County Fire Chief Pat Sullivan said first responders from Harrison County, Lizana, AMR and Gulfport Fire Department responded to a kitchen fire in a duplex Tuesday night.

The fire was on 29th Street in Harrison County. It was reported around 10 p.m.

Sullivan said the fire which was caused by a stove that had not been turned off. The fire caused damage to one apartment and smoke damage to the other.

No one was injured during the fire.
